Vác is one of the oldest towns of Hungary and the second oldest bishopry seat of the country. This beautiful Hungarian town on the Danube shore, for 30 km from Budapest is rich in sights and history. A really pleasant halfway excursion from the rushed city! Though not visited nearly as much as either Szentendre or Visegrád on the opposite shore, it can become a pleasant and enjoyable stop over in Hungary...Stroll on Danube promenade, see the old merchanthouses and roman ruins on the main square, visit the magnificent chatedral made by Italian masters. visit Hungary's most unique museum, Memento Mori, see the oldest stonebridge and the only Triumphal Arch of Hungary on a private tour!

After exploring Budapest's most popular attractions, take a leisurely bike ride around the city center to discover lesser-known locations and their captivating stories. Start your tour in the city center near Astoria. Pedal across one of Europe's most stunning suspension bridges and enter into the Art Nouveau hall of the Gellért Baths. Peek into the pool area and learn about Budapest's rich spa culture. Ride through the old streets of Pest Downtown, explore gardens popular with locals, and stop on squares filled with 19th-century noble palaces. Bike through the narrow streets of the old Jewish Quarter later became a flourishing ruin bar district in the late '90s. Admire the street art and murals, stop by a local market and marvel at small synagogues. Finally, ride along Andrassy Avenue and pass the Opera House, Elisabeth Square on your way.
